Document translation services prices in UAE

The price of translation services in Dubai depends on several key factors, including:
1. Document type and level of specialization:
- General documents, such as ordinary letters or informal personal documents, are less expensive.
- Specialized documents, such as legal documents (contracts, court rulings), medical documents (medical reports, research), technical documents (technical manuals), or marketing documents. These documents require expertise and in-depth knowledge of specialized terminology, which increases their cost.
- Certified/Legal Translation: If the document requires a certified translation for use in government entities or courts, it is more expensive because it requires a translator certified by the UAE Ministry of Justice.
2. Number of words or pages:
- Word count is the primary and most common factor for determining cost.
- POA&More uses per-page pricing.
3. Language pairs:
- Translation between common languages (such as English and Arabic) is relatively lower due to the availability of a large number of qualified translators.
- Translation from or into rare or less common languages is more expensive due to the small number of translators specializing in these language pairs.
4. Time required to complete the translation (urgency):

Average Cost of Translation Services in the UAE
Translation services Dubai prices are affected by many factors that can lead to significant variations in translation services Dubai prices. Here are the most important factors determining translation charges in Dubai:
1. Type of translation and field of specialization:
- General translation: This is the least expensive and includes the translation of non-specialized texts such as letters, general articles, and personal texts.
- Specialized translation: This requires expertise and knowledge of specific terminology in certain fields, which increases literary translation rates. This includes:
- Legal translation: such as the translation of contracts, official documents, birth and marriage certificates.
- Medical translation: This includes medical reports, prescriptions, and research studies.
- Technical translation: such as the translation of engineering manuals, software, and user manuals.
- Financial and commercial translation: This includes financial reports and commercial contracts.
- Simultaneous translation: This cost is much higher than written translation and is calculated by the hour.
2. Language pair (source and target language):
- Common languages: Translation between common languages such as Arabic and English is less expensive due to the availability of a greater number of specialized translators.
- Rare Languages: Translation charges in the UAE may be higher for less common languages such as Japanese, Korean, Chinese, or some European languages due to the scarcity of qualified translators.
3. Text Size and Complexity:
- Number of Words/Pages: The more words or pages you need to translate, the higher the overall project cost. However, some companies may offer discounts for larger projects.
- Text Complexity: Texts containing complex terminology or requiring a special style (such as literary texts) may increase the price.
4. Delivery Time (Urgency):
Urgent Translation: If you need your translation delivered within a short timeframe (such as within 24 hours), an additional fee of up to 50% of the translation services Dubai price will likely apply.
5. Additional Services:
- Proofreading and Review: If the service includes review and proofreading of the text by another translator to ensure accuracy, an additional cost may apply.
- Formatting and Design: The translation cost may increase if it requires special document formatting or professional design, especially in the case of non-editable PDF files.
- Certification and Notarization: If you require a translation certified by a government attorney or embassy, this adds an additional cost to the document translation services cost.

How to Reduce the Cost of Translation?
How much does legal translation cost? Dubai is a global business hub, which increases the demand for translation services. However, translation costs can be high. Here are some ways you can reduce your translation cost in Dubai:
Choose the right type of service:
- Machine translation: This may be suitable for simple, non-sensitive documents, but remember that the quality may not be perfect and will require careful review.
- Human translation: This is the best option for accurate, high-quality translation, but it is more expensive. You can choose freelance translators or translation companies.
- Written translation: If you have a preliminary translation, you can request an editing service to correct errors and improve style.
Determine the size of the project:
- Divide the project into smaller parts: It may be easier and less expensive to translate parts of the document separately.
- Prioritize: Translate only the most important parts in the first stage.
Choose the right time:
- Avoid peak periods: Prices are usually higher during peak periods such as holidays and conferences.
- Plan ahead: If you have enough time, you can order your translation in advance to get better prices.
